Jacks Close Brazil Trip
The South Dakota State men’s basketball team closed out its Brookings to Brazil Tour on Sunday with a dominating 114-63 win over Botafogo, a team from the Brazilian A1 League, the top league in the country.
Injured Viking Returns
Defensive tackle Linval Joseph has rejoined the Minnesota Vikings after being shot in the leg at a bar, and he is expected to recover in time for the start of the regular season.
SDSU Rates Top Ten
The South Dakota State University football team will enter the 2014 season with a pair of top-10 preseason rankings as the Jackrabbits checked in at No. 10 in the Sports Network Football Championship Subdivision preseason poll.
